Christmas is a time for delicious desserts that bring joy to your holiday feast.
From chocolate cakes and cheesecakes to puddings and cookies, the options are endless for creating sweet treats that will impress your family and friends.
These 21 best Christmas dessert recipes offer something for everyone, whether you prefer classic flavors or want to try something new.
You’ll find impressive yet achievable recipes that range from rich chocolate delights to fruity puddings.
Many can be made with just a few ingredients, making your holiday baking less stressful while still delivering wonderful results.

1. Bûche de Noël
Bûche de Noël, also known as a Yule Log cake, is a classic French Christmas dessert. This festive cake resembles a holiday log and makes a stunning centerpiece for your holiday table.
The traditional version features a tender chocolate sponge cake rolled with cream filling. Many recipes use a flourless chocolate cake base for a rich, decadent flavor.
Once rolled, the cake is covered with chocolate ganache or buttercream and decorated to look like bark.
Bakers often add meringue mushrooms, sugared cranberries, or a dusting of powdered sugar “snow” for the full woodland effect.
You can customize your Bûche de Noël with different fillings like mascarpone whipped cream for a modern twist on this holiday classic.

2. Flourless Chocolate Espresso Cake
This decadent chocolate cake is a perfect addition to your Christmas dessert table. Made with just seven simple ingredients, it features high-quality chocolate, eggs, sugar, and espresso powder for an intense flavor combination.
The cake has a unique texture with a crispy top crust and a rich, fudgy interior that chocolate lovers will adore. It’s naturally gluten-free, making it a great option for guests with dietary restrictions.
For an extra special touch, you can top it with cacao nibs or serve it with a chocolate caramel espresso sauce.
The deep chocolate flavor paired with coffee notes creates a sophisticated dessert that’s surprisingly easy to prepare.

3. Pumpkin Gingerbread Trifle
This stunning dessert combines two beloved holiday flavors – pumpkin and gingerbread – in one impressive treat. Instead of traditional sponge cake, this trifle uses robust gingerbread as its base.
The layers include chunks of gingerbread, a light pumpkin mousse, and fluffy whipped cream. These components create a beautiful presentation when assembled in a clear trifle bowl.
You can assemble this dessert by placing 1/3 of the gingerbread at the bottom, followed by 1/3 of the pumpkin filling, and 1/3 of the whipped topping. Repeat twice more to create lovely layers.
For an extra touch, garnish the top with chopped nuts. It’s an easy yet impressive alternative to traditional pumpkin pie for your holiday table.

4. Black Forest Cake
Black Forest Cake is a stunning Christmas dessert that combines rich chocolate cake with sweet cherries and creamy whipped topping. It’s a classic that never fails to impress holiday guests.
The traditional recipe features chocolate cake layers soaked with cherry liqueur for extra flavor. Between each layer, you’ll find cherry pie filling and fresh whipped cream.
You can make this dessert ahead of time, which helps reduce stress during holiday preparations. Some recipes offer simpler versions that take just minutes to prepare.
For a beautiful presentation, top your Black Forest Cake with chocolate shavings and fresh cherries. The contrast of dark chocolate, white cream, and red cherries creates a festive look perfect for your Christmas table.

5. Brandied Cherry Clafouti
Brandied Cherry Clafouti is a French dessert that combines baked cherries with a custard-like batter. The dessert has a unique texture that falls somewhere between a cake and a sweet quiche.
For this recipe, tart cherries are soaked in brandy and sugar before baking. This adds a rich, holiday flavor perfect for Christmas celebrations.
The batter often includes lemon and warming spices like allspice, which complement the brandied cherries beautifully. When baked, the clafouti puffs up around the fruit.
You can serve this elegant dessert warm from the oven for your holiday gathering. It works equally well as a special brunch item or a sophisticated dessert.

6. Biscochitos
Biscochitos are traditional New Mexican cookies that make a perfect addition to your Christmas dessert spread. These crisp, light, and tender cookies are similar to shortbread but with a unique flavor profile.
What makes biscochitos special is their distinctive taste of anise seed and cinnamon. The traditional recipe uses lard for an authentic texture, but you can find versions without lard or eggs to accommodate different dietary needs.
You can easily make these at home by creaming fat with sugar and anise seed, adding eggs, and mixing in sifted dry ingredients. Once baked, the cookies are typically rolled in a cinnamon-sugar mixture while still warm.
These festive treats pair wonderfully with hot chocolate or coffee during holiday gatherings.

7. Sticky Date and Pecan Pudding
Sticky Date and Pecan Pudding is a decadent dessert perfect for your Christmas table. It combines elements of classic sticky toffee pudding with self-saucing pudding for an irresistible treat.
The dessert features chopped dates and pecans mixed into a moist cake batter. When baked, it emerges warm and nutty with rich flavor throughout.
The real magic comes from the sweet toffee sauce that coats this pudding. For balance, serve with a dollop of whipped cream on top.
This alternative to traditional Christmas pudding will surely please everyone at your holiday gathering. It’s sinfully delicious with its combination of dates, pecans, and caramel notes.

8. Chocolate Caramel Tart
A Chocolate Caramel Tart makes a stunning addition to your Christmas dessert table. This elegant treat features a buttery crust topped with layers of gooey caramel and rich chocolate ganache.
You can find both baked and no-bake versions to suit your preference. Some recipes use Oreos and store-bought caramels for an easier approach.
For extra flavor, try adding a sprinkle of sea salt on top to create a salted caramel chocolate tart. The sweet-salty combination adds complexity that your guests will love.
This dessert looks impressive but is surprisingly manageable to make, even with homemade caramel. The tart is best served at room temperature for the perfect texture.

9. Pecan Pralines
Pecan pralines are a classic Southern treat that makes a perfect Christmas dessert. These soft, creamy candies blend toasted pecans with a mixture of white and brown sugars for the ideal balance of sweetness and nutty flavor.
You can make these entirely on the stovetop by boiling the ingredients until they reach the right consistency. The recipe typically calls for pecans, white sugar, brown sugar, milk, butter, and vanilla extract.
Pralines make excellent homemade gifts for the holidays. They’re also a wonderful addition to your Christmas dessert table alongside other traditional treats.

10. Gâteau Nana
Gâteau Nana is a beautifully simple yet rustic cake that will impress your holiday guests. This elegant dessert features a delicious pecan cream filling that adds richness to every bite.
The recipe was adapted from one developed by Melissa Martin, who drew inspiration from Nancy Brewer’s version. Despite its sophisticated appearance, this cake is surprisingly approachable to make.
You don’t need advanced baking skills to create this showstopper. The combination of delicate cake layers and nutty cream creates a balanced flavor profile that works perfectly as the finale to your Christmas dinner.

11. Holiday Gingerbread Cake
Holiday Gingerbread Cake brings the warm flavor of winter to your dessert table. This festive treat features layers of spiced gingerbread cake covered with creamy frosting.
The cake is typically crowned with a cream cheese frosting that perfectly balances the spicy notes of the gingerbread. Some versions create a winter wonderland by surrounding the cake with gingerbread cookie trees.
For an extra holiday touch, you can decorate with sugared cranberries and rosemary sprigs. These decorations create a beautiful snowy forest effect that will impress your guests.
This dessert combines traditional holiday flavors in an impressive presentation that looks as good as it tastes.

12. No-Bake Eggnog Pie
Looking for the perfect dessert after a big Christmas dinner? This creamy, cold no-bake eggnog pie is your answer.
It takes just 15 minutes to prep and delivers all the classic holiday flavors. The smooth texture comes from a mix of eggnog, cream cheese, and cool whip.
Add a splash of bourbon and a sprinkle of nutmeg for that authentic eggnog taste. This pie is super simple to make ahead of time, giving you one less thing to worry about on Christmas day.
Your holiday table won’t be complete without this easy, delicious treat that captures the spirit of the season.

13. Oreo Fudge
Oreo Fudge is a simple yet impressive Christmas dessert that requires minimal ingredients. You can make this creamy treat with just white chocolate chips, sweetened condensed milk, Oreos, and a pinch of salt.
The preparation is quick – taking only about 15 minutes of your time. For a festive touch, use Christmas-themed Oreos that add color and holiday spirit to your fudge.
The result is a decadent, creamy fudge filled with chunks of cookie that will satisfy any sweet tooth. It’s perfect for holiday parties or as a homemade gift for friends and family.

14. Cornflake Wreaths
Cornflake Wreaths are classic no-bake Christmas cookies that bring holiday cheer to any dessert table. These festive treats are made with just a few simple ingredients.
To make them, you’ll need butter, miniature marshmallows, green food coloring, corn flakes cereal, and some red candies for decoration. The process is similar to making rice krispy treats.
Melt the butter and marshmallows together, add green food coloring, and then mix in the corn flakes. Shape the mixture into wreath forms and add red candies to look like berries before they set.
These bright green wreaths are perfect for cookie exchanges and holiday gatherings. They’re quick to make and always a hit with kids and adults alike.

15. Gingersnaps
Gingersnaps are classic holiday cookies that bring warmth to any Christmas dessert table. These spiced treats have a distinctive crackly surface and can be made either crisp or chewy, depending on your preference.
The key ingredients include ginger, cinnamon, and molasses, which give them their rich flavor and color. Many people consider gingersnaps a favorite holiday cookie for their aromatic spices and nostalgic appeal.
You can roll the dough in cinnamon sugar before baking for an extra touch of sweetness and sparkle. They pair wonderfully with hot beverages and make excellent gifts during the festive season.

16. Christmas Sheet Cake
Christmas sheet cake is a perfect dessert for holiday gatherings. This festive treat features a tender vanilla cake base topped with creamy frosting.
Many versions are decorated as Christmas trees using green frosting and colorful sprinkles or candies as ornaments. The simple rectangular shape makes it easy to serve to a crowd.
You can customize your Christmas sheet cake with different flavors like chocolate, red velvet, or peppermint. Some recipes include cream cheese frosting for extra richness.
Sheet cakes are simpler to make than layer cakes, making them ideal for busy holiday preparations. They’re also easier to transport to parties and family gatherings.

17. Sugar Cookie Biscotti
Sugar Cookie Biscotti combines the crisp texture of traditional biscotti with the sweet flavor of sugar cookies. These twice-baked treats are perfect for holiday gatherings.
You can make these with simple pantry ingredients—no fancy substitutes needed. The basic recipe includes flour, sugar, eggs, and vanilla, but you can customize it with add-ins.
Try adding dried cranberries and lemon zest for a festive twist. These biscotti stay fresh longer than regular cookies, making them ideal for gift-giving during the Christmas season.
Dip them in white chocolate and add sprinkles for a truly holiday-worthy presentation that pairs perfectly with coffee or hot chocolate.

18. Potato Candy
Potato candy is a classic Christmas treat that dates back to the 1930s. This simple dessert requires just a few basic ingredients.
Start by boiling a peeled russet potato until soft. Mash it well and add about 1/2 teaspoon of vanilla extract.
Next, gradually mix in powdered sugar (8-10 cups) until you form a dough. The mixture will be runny at first but will thicken as you add more sugar.
Roll out the dough, spread peanut butter over the surface, and roll it up like a cinnamon roll. Slice into pinwheels before serving.
This sweet, old-fashioned candy is sure to bring nostalgic Christmas cheer to your holiday table.

19. Brandy Snaps
Brandy snaps are delicate, crisp cookies that curl into tubes when hot and can be filled with cream. They’re perfect for holiday entertaining and make an elegant addition to your Christmas dessert table.
You can make these thin, golden treats with simple ingredients like butter, sugar, and golden syrup. Their distinctive flavor comes from ginger and a hint of brandy or lemon juice.
After baking, you need to work quickly to shape them while warm. Once cooled, fill them with whipped cream for a classic finish.
These impressive-looking cookies are actually easier to make than they appear. You can prepare them ahead of time and fill just before serving.

20. Pavlova
Pavlova is a stunning dessert that makes a perfect centerpiece for your Christmas table. This meringue-based treat features a crisp exterior with a soft, marshmallow-like interior.
You can top your pavlova with traditional holiday flavors. Fresh berries, whipped cream, and lemon curd are popular choices that add festive colors to this elegant dessert.
For a creative twist, consider making a Christmas tree pavlova. Stack rounds of meringue in decreasing sizes to create a tree shape, then decorate with cream and seasonal fruits.
This light dessert provides a nice contrast to heavier holiday meals. Your guests will appreciate this beautiful and delicious alternative to traditional Christmas sweets.

21. Christmas Cookies
Christmas cookies are a must-have holiday treat. They bring warmth and sweetness to any celebration during the festive season.
You can try classic options like gingerbread, sugar cookies, or shortbread. These favorites appear in most holiday cookie collections for good reason – they’re delicious and traditional.
For something different, consider potato chip cookies that offer a sweet-salty combination. Spritz cookies are another excellent choice that look impressive but are actually quite simple to make.
Cookie swaps or exchanges are popular during Christmas. You can bake a large batch of your favorite recipe and trade with friends for a variety of treats.
Understanding Traditional Christmas Desserts
Christmas desserts combine centuries of tradition with sweet innovation. Each treat has a story that connects to cultural heritage and seasonal celebrations around the world.
The History of Christmas Sweets
Christmas desserts date back to medieval times when spices like cinnamon, nutmeg, and cloves were precious commodities. These ingredients were saved for special occasions, making holiday treats truly special.
Fruitcake originated in ancient Rome as a way to preserve fruit with honey and spices. By the 16th century, sugar became more available, allowing for the creation of more elaborate Christmas confections.
Many desserts were developed for practical reasons. Christmas pudding started as a preservation method for meat using dried fruits and spices. It evolved into the sweet dessert we know today.
Religious symbolism appears in many treats. The Yule log cake (Bûche de Noël) represents the ancient tradition of burning a special log for warmth and good luck during winter solstice celebrations.
Regional Variations in Holiday Desserts
Each country has distinctive Christmas desserts that reflect local ingredients and traditions. In Italy, you’ll find panettone, a sweet bread studded with candied fruits. Germans celebrate with stollen, a fruit bread with marzipan.
Scandinavian countries embrace gingerbread in various forms. Swedish pepparkakor cookies and Norwegian pepperkaker are thin, crisp cookies flavored with ginger and cinnamon.
In Eastern Europe, poppy seeds feature prominently in Christmas desserts like Polish makowiec (poppy seed roll) and Hungarian beigli.
Latin American countries often incorporate tropical fruits and spices. Mexican buñuelos are fried dough fritters topped with cinnamon sugar, while Brazilian rabanadas resemble French toast soaked in wine.
British-influenced countries typically serve rich Christmas pudding or fruitcake, often doused with brandy and set aflame for dramatic presentation.
Tips for Baking the Perfect Christmas Dessert
Creating delicious holiday treats requires attention to ingredients and technique. These simple tips will help you avoid common mistakes and ensure your Christmas desserts turn out perfectly every time.
Choosing the Right Ingredients
Always use fresh ingredients for the best results. Check expiration dates on baking powder and baking soda, as these lose potency over time.
Butter should be at the right temperature for your recipe. For cookies and cakes, room temperature butter (soft but still cool to touch) creates the best texture. For pie crusts, cold butter is essential.
Use high-quality vanilla extract instead of imitation vanilla for richer flavor. Real vanilla may cost more, but the taste difference is noticeable.
Consider seasonal spices like cinnamon, nutmeg, and cloves to add holiday warmth. Measure spices carefully – too much can overpower your dessert.
Keep eggs at room temperature for better mixing. Cold eggs can cause batters to curdle or ingredients to separate.
Baking Techniques for Foolproof Results
Always preheat your oven completely before baking.
An oven thermometer can confirm your oven reaches the correct temperature.
Measure ingredients precisely using proper tools.
Use dry measuring cups for flour and sugar, and liquid measuring cups for milk and oils.
Flour measuring tip: Spoon flour into measuring cups rather than scooping, then level with a knife. This prevents using too much flour, which makes desserts dry.
Don’t overmix batters once flour is added.
Overmixing develops gluten, resulting in tough cookies and dense cakes.
Rotate pans halfway through baking for even browning.
Keep oven door closed during the first half of baking time to prevent temperature fluctuations.
Allow proper cooling time.
Most desserts need to cool completely before frosting or storing to prevent sogginess.